Are events a good way to raise money?
A special event can be a great way to raise funds and gain positive publicity at the same time. Events also allow some businesses that would like to contribute, but can’t give money, a way to help through in-kind donations. Events take a lot of planning (use your fundraising committee), time, and volunteer power, but many RIF programs nationwide successfully hold creative and fun events year round. What kind of plan do I need? If you decide to host a special event or sale, there are some things you need to address (before, during, and after) no matter what the event is. Planning: • Date and Time: Check your community calendars so your fundraiser doesn’t conflict with other events. Steer away from school vacations or religious holidays. On the other hand, holding an event in conjunction with a program like Back-to-School night assures you of an already captive audience. • Place: Will there be enough room? Check electrical outlets and safety. Draw up a floor plan and seating arrangements
